E. Ranucci et al., ON THE SUITABILITY OF URETHANE BONDS BETWEEN THE CARRIER AND THE DRUGMOIETY IN POLY(ETHYLENEGLYCOL)-BASED OLIGOMERIC PRODRUGS, Journal of biomaterials science. Polymer ed., 6(2), 1994, pp. 133-139
Some poly(ethyleneglycol) derivatives of propranolol were prepared, in
which the drug molecule was linked to the oligomeric carrier via uret
hane bonds in order to study the suitability of this bond as a linkage
between the carrier and the drug moiety in oligomeric prodrugs. For c
omparison purposes also ethanol- and butanol-based prodrugs of propran
olol were prepared, with the same linkage between drug and promoiety.
The urethane compounds were obtained by condensation via N,N'-carbonyl
diimidazole. None of these compounds gave rise to appreciable blood co
ncentrations of propranolol after oral administration, thus suggesting
in this particular case, a relative in vivo resistance of urethane bo
nds towards cleavage.
